Misconceptions about Democracy and the Importance of Building Institutions

This chapter explores the misconception that democracy is predictable and highlights the importance of building institutions and developing a middle class for a stable democracy. It also addresses the dysfunctionality of democracies in developing countries and challenges the American assumption of imposing their history on other parts of the world.
